AUTHOR

Stim, Richard W.

SUMMARY

If you belong to a band and love the art of your job, but sing the blues when it comes to the business, you need Music Law.Composed by musician and lawyer Richard Stim, the book explains how to:* book performances* choose a name and protect its use* copyright song lyrics* establish legal ownership of songs* sample legally* sign contracts* write a band partnership agreementThe best guide available for bands today, Music Law provides all the legal information and practical advice musicians need to keep from getting burned.All legal forms and agreements included, as tear-outs and on CDROM.Stim, Richard W. is the author of 'Music Law How To Run Your Band's Business', published 2004 under ISBN 9781413300857 and ISBN 1413300855.
